Цикл статей «Документация jqGrid на русском».
Следующая статья — «Редактирование ячейки в jqGrid».
Предыдущая статья — «Свойство editrules в jqGrid».
Это свойство имеет смысл только при редактировании в форме. Цель этого свойства — переупорядочить элементы в форме и добавить некоторую информацию перед и после элементом редактирования. Должно использоваться в colModel. Синтаксис:
1 2 3 4 5 6 7 8 9 10 11 |
<script> jQuery("#grid_id").jqGrid({ ... colModel: [ ... {name:'price', ..., formoptions:{elmprefix:'(*)', rowpos:1, colpos:2....}, editable:true }, ... ] ... }); </script> |
Если вы планируете использовать этот объект в colModel со свойствами rowpos и colpos, то рекомендуется использовать эти свойства для всех редактируемых полей.
Свойство: elmprefix
Тип: string
Если установлено, текст или HTML появляется перед элементом ввода.
Свойство: elmsuffix
Тип: string
Если установлено, текст или HTML появляется после элемента ввода.
Свойство: label
Тип: string
Если установлено, заменяет имя из colNames, которое появляется как надпись в форме.
Свойство: rowpos
Тип: number
Определяет позицию строки для элемента (вместе с текстовой надписью) в форме. Счёт позиций начинается с 1.
Свойство: colpos
Тип: number
Определяет позицию колонки для элемента (вместе с надписью) в форме. Счёт позиций начинается с 1.
Два элемента могут иметь одинаковые позиции строки, но разные позиции колонки. Это установит элементы в одной строке в форме.
Цикл статей «Документация jqGrid на русском».
Следующая статья — «Редактирование ячейки в jqGrid».
Предыдущая статья — «Свойство editrules в jqGrid».